Output d61aeb047eec7f2b39361c4c5ac506ae67477f7d12d5a491924cce25831edfef:1

value
2605891724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f80c02dffe114e56092b3d55a02d78cb3786e03 OP_EQUAL
address
3LcC31RzxrPo12r7swRPojkoMUkAzobPvn
transaction
d61aeb047eec7f2b39361c4c5ac506ae67477f7d12d5a491924cce25831edfef
spent
true